idsw依赖spark环境及其他的大数据仓库组件,它们主要通过Ambari安装。
ambari支持livy和livy2
livy2
以使用的ambari环境为例,ambari版本2.5.1.0
当启动"livy2 for spark2"失败时,可能是找不到livy2-server。
通常livy2的位置是/usr/hdp/2.6.1.0-129/livy2
而ambari启动"livy2 for spark2"的脚本可能查找的位置是/usr/hdp/current/livy2-server
这时候可以创建目录软链接
$ ln -sv /usr/hdp/2.6.1.0-129/livy2 /usr/hdp/current/livy2-server
注意:删除软链接的方式是
$ rm -rf /usr/hdp/current/livy2-server
而不是
$ rm -rf /usr/hdp/current/livy2-server/